Brent crude settled at $118.35 on 31 March 2026, the highest level of the crisis. On 1 July it closed at $71.57 — below where it traded the day the war began. Between those two dates the Strait of Hormuz, which had carried about a fifth of the world's oil, was closed, fought over, partially cleared of mines, and then shut again; a ceasefire was declared, collapsed, and was replaced by an expired memorandum; and Qatar's LNG output, force-majeured in March, was still largely unable to leave the Gulf.
A market that loses a fifth of its supply and ends the quarter unchanged is not a market that has digested a shock. It is a market in which something else absorbed the shock. This report reconstructs, from the primary data now available, what that something else was, how much of the gap it covered, and which parts of the oil market never returned to their pre-war condition even as the price did.
What the closure removed, in barrels
The baseline first. The US Energy Information Administration's chokepoint analysis — the reference series for Hormuz volumes — put crude, condensate and petroleum-product transits at roughly 20 million barrels per day in the first half of 2025, about a quarter of the world's seaborne oil trade. The destination is as important as the volume: China, India, Japan and South Korea take about three-quarters of the crude moving through the strait, which is why Asia's refineries, not the futures market in London, were the first price-takers in this crisis.

Iran closed the strait to foreign shipping in the days after the US–Israeli strikes of 28 February, with the IRGC announcing "complete control" on 4 March. The EIA's first crisis-quarter accounting, published in May, measured the result: Q1 2026 transits averaged 14.6 million barrels per day — roughly 30 percent below the year-earlier level. That is the measured decline, and it is worth pausing on its size: a 5–6 million barrel per day reduction in the world's most-traded waterway, in a single quarter, is larger than anything in the post-1973 record, the judgment the IEA's executive director formalised on 20 March when he described the war as creating "the largest supply disruption in the history of the global oil market."
Two caveats attach to the Q1 figure before it is used. First, it is an average over a quarter in which the closure tightened week by week; the daily rate by late March was lower than the average, and the flows that continued included Iran-approved cargoes, mostly bound for China and India, some under naval escort. Second, producer-side estimates ran higher than the transit measurements: reported output losses across Kuwait, Iraq, Saudi Arabia and the UAE reached 6.7 million barrels per day by 10 March and were estimated at 10 million or more by 12 March, partly because export infrastructure — loading terminals, escort-dependent routes — could not operate even where production continued. The gap between what fields produced and what tankers could load was one of the crisis's defining frictions.
Kpler's tanker-tracking data, published on 20 August, measures the same system on a narrower basis — oil cargoes exiting the Gulf — on which the 2025 average was about 15 million barrels per day. On that measure the blockade months were starved to 2.3 million barrels per day, or roughly 15 percent of normal.
The emergency bridge: the largest stock release ever attempted
The gap between what the Gulf exported and what the world's refiners needed was bridged, in the first instance, by the member governments of the International Energy Agency.

On 11 March 2026 — twelve days into the closure — the IEA's 32 member countries unanimously agreed to release 400 million barrels from emergency reserves, the largest collective action in the agency's fifty-year history, against the 182.7 million barrels of the 2022 release and 60 million in 2011. By 21 July, the IEA reported that members had delivered 290 million barrels of that commitment, with roughly a billion barrels of emergency stocks still in the ground. The scale deserves one sentence of context: at a delivery pace comparable to the earlier releases, 290 million barrels over four and a half months amounts to roughly 2 million barrels per day of additional supply — not enough to replace a 20-million-barrel waterway, but enough to replace a large share of the measured Q1 shortfall while other adjustments took hold.
The other adjustments were already in the market before the crisis began. The IEA's March Oil Market Report assessed global observed crude and product inventories at more than 8.2 billion barrels — the highest level in the series' recent record — which means the shock arrived into a system holding months of demand as stock. OPEC+ producers outside the Gulf held spare capacity through the period. And demand did not collapse: the IMF, revising its World Economic Outlook in July, kept 2026 global growth at 3.0 percent, judging — per its own statement — that the oil shock's drag was being offset by AI-driven investment demand, a conclusion consistent with equity markets recovering through the crisis (the S&P 500, after falling to 6,316.91 on 30 March, closed at 7,411.98 on 24 July).

The physical recovery, when it came, was partial and temporary. During the 60 days the US–Iran memorandum of understanding was in force — signed 17 June, expired 17 August — Kpler counted 374 million barrels exiting the Gulf, about 6.1 million barrels per day: nearly triple the blockade rate, but roughly 40 percent of the 2025 baseline on the firm's own comparison. More than half of those cargoes moved in the first three weeks of the agreement; Kpler's market-data head described the flow's final weeks as thinner, darker and re-accumulating behind the chokepoint. After the memorandum expired, Lloyd's List Intelligence's preliminary count recorded 73 transits in the week of 10–16 August against 91 the week before, and the UK Maritime Trade Operations centre logged attacks on five commercial vessels in the same period.
The bypass arithmetic: what the pipelines could and could not do
The Gulf's producers have spent four decades building partial exits from the strait, and the crisis tested them. The US Energy Information Administration's March 2026 chokepoint analysis puts existing usable bypass capacity — Saudi Arabia's East–West pipeline to the Red Sea and the UAE's Habshan–Fujairah line — at about 4.7 million barrels per day. Saudi Aramco said on 10 March that roughly 5 million barrels per day could be made available on the East–West system, whose total nameplate capacity is 7 million: the difference is the line's existing commitment to domestic refining and Red Sea markets. The UAE, which exports roughly 1.5 million barrels per day through Fujairah, is fast-tracking a second pipeline to lift that to about 3.6 million by mid-2027, according to Kpler's infrastructure analysis.
Set against the shortfall, the arithmetic is sobering. The Q1 transit decline on the EIA's basis was roughly 5.4 million barrels per day; the total usable bypass capacity was less than that on its own, and much of it was already in use before the war, serving markets it reaches more cheaply than a Red Sea route would. Bypass pipelines are built for diversification, not substitution: they cover a fraction of a 20-million-barrel waterway, they serve crude but not the LNG trade (no pipeline exits Qatar for the sea lanes), and their expansion timelines — the UAE's measured in years — are set by construction, not by ceasefires. The gap between what the pipelines offered and what the strait carried is the single best reason the emergency stock release had to do the work it did.
Asia, the offtaker of three-quarters of the strait
The crisis's demand side was always going to be Asian. Roughly three-quarters of the crude transiting Hormuz is bound for China, India, Japan and South Korea, with Pakistan and Bangladesh among the most price-sensitive smaller buyers and Singapore and Taiwan disproportionately dependent on Qatari LNG. The stranding of that trade produced the crisis's most distinctive shortages: the Philippines declared a national emergency on 24 March as fuel distribution failed; Vietnam, Zimbabwe, Pakistan, Bangladesh and Nigeria saw comparable disruption; and analysts quoted in the regional press described the panic buying in better-stocked India and Australia as a distribution problem rather than a supply one.
The exception that proved the rule ran through the closure itself: Iran-approved vessels, mostly bound for China and India, continued to transit the strait from the war's earliest days, some under escort. The two largest buyers of seaborne crude kept buying — discounted, escorted, and outside the insurance market that had repriced everyone else. That asymmetry matters for reading the price: the marginal barrel that remained available through the blockade was flowing to exactly the economies that set seaborne crude's marginal price, which is one reason the price signal stayed orderly even as Western-origin traffic collapsed. It is also, so far as the public record shows, the quiet beginning of a structural question Asian refiners will carry beyond the war — what premium their route security now commands.
The precedent: the 1980s Tanker War, at a faster tempo
The Gulf has fought a shipping war before. Between 1984 and 1988, in the Iran–Iraq War's so-called Tanker War, Iraq attacked merchant shipping 283 times and Iran 168 times — 451 attacks killing 116 merchant sailors, by the US Naval History and Heritage Command's tally. The strait was never fully closed: oil kept moving at higher cost, the United States reflagged and escorted Kuwaiti tankers from 1987, and the market absorbed the losses as a running toll.
The 2026 tempo exceeds it. The International Maritime Organization counted 46 attacks on commercial shipping in the first hundred days of this war — an annualised rate well above the Tanker War's four-year average — with attacks continuing across the April ceasefire. What has not yet repeated is the precedent's outcome: escorts and reflagging kept 1980s tonnage moving, and the 2026 equivalent — the US escort announcements of March, the mine-clearance campaign — has so far produced only partial recovery. Whether that is tempo, tactics, or the sheer density of traffic now trapped behind the chokepoint is a question the available data does not answer.
The mines and the queue
Two physical facts about the strait itself defined the summer's ceiling. The first is mines: by 25 August, US officials confirmed that the Navy had cleared the strait's traffic separation scheme, with underwater drones having identified more than 100 suspected mines that private contractors then removed or detonated. The figure is itself a measurement of method — a scanning-and-clearance campaign run largely by contractors rather than a fleet operation — and it is the mechanism behind the Trump administration's repeated claims that the strait is "open", claims the transit counts complicate.
The second is the queue. At its June reporting date the IMO estimated roughly 1,000 ships and 20,000 crew held in the Arabian Gulf, a stranding then more than 100 days old — container ships, bulkers and gas carriers with no cargo to load and no safe exit, alongside the tankers. The crew dimension is the crisis's least-priced cost: 18 seafarers confirmed killed by 20 August, wages renegotiated at war rates, and repatriation logistics that shipping associations described in terms normally reserved for natural disasters. No futures curve prices this. It enters the economy later, as crew costs, insurance loadings and the slow re-routing decisions of owners who decide the Gulf is no longer worth the delay.

Three features of this arc matter for what follows. The peak-to-trough decline was 40 percent — in a quarter when the strait's flows, on the Kpler measure, went from 15 percent of normal to not much more. The return to the pre-war price occurred before the memorandum was signed, not after — the low came on 1 July, seventeen days before the Versailles signature. And the price has since settled into a band roughly 40 percent above pre-war levels, which is the market's own ongoing estimate of what a partially-blocked strait is worth.
Why the price fell while the strait stayed shut
The chronological facts are easy to state; their weighting is not, and this section is deliberately more cautious than the chronology. What the evidence supports is a set of four contributors whose relative sizes the public data cannot separate.
Strategic stocks did the mechanical work. The 290 million barrels the IEA delivered by late July is, at the delivery rates implied by the agency's own reporting, a multi-million-barrel-per-day supplement sustained across the exact window in which prices fell from $118 to $71. That is an observation about timing and scale, not a measured causal share — no dataset isolates the release's price effect from everything else — but the correlation in the timeline is strong, and it is the largest deliberate supply addition in the market's history arriving during the price's decline.
The market was pricing reopening, not recovery. Futures are claims on future delivery, and from the ceasefire of 8 April onward each diplomatic step — the April ceasefire, the May pause of "Project Freedom," the mine-clearance announcements, the June memorandum — moved the expected future supply curve before any physical barrel moved. Brent's low arriving before the memorandum's signature is consistent with that forward-looking structure: the price anticipated the reopening's anticipation, so to speak, and corrected for real flows only partially and later. The New York Times' late-June framing — prices back to pre-war levels four months after the shock — captured the same asymmetry from the demand side.
Inventories and demand made the shock absorbable. The 8.2-billion-barrel inventory base meant refiners facing lost Gulf barrels could buy from stock rather than bid for cargoes. Held-flat global growth meant the demand destruction that would otherwise have forced prices down was not required. Several analysts quoted through the crisis, and the IMF explicitly, attributed the contained macro damage to these starting conditions rather than to any virtue of the market's price signal.
The precedent channel compressed the risk premium. In the June 2025 Twelve-Day War, a $10–15 per barrel risk premium had dissipated within days of ceasefire, as MCB Group's market analysis noted; the 1990 and 2003 shocks saw prices round-trip within months. Traders who had watched 2025's premium evaporate had documented grounds for treating this crisis's peak as inflated, and the subsequent behaviour of the price — its willingness to fall 8.7 percent on a single pause announcement — is what a market trading a decompressing premium looks like.
The honest summary: the round trip was the joint product of record-scale policy intervention, forward-looking pricing, comfortable starting inventories, and a demand base that did not crack. The evidence does not support assigning the shares among them, and claims that any single one "caused" the round trip go beyond what the data can show.
What never round-tripped
The futures contract returned to pre-war levels. The cost of actually moving oil through the Gulf did not, and by the end of the summer the gap between the two was the clearest single measurement the crisis produced.
Insurance. Additional hull war-risk premium for a Gulf voyage — roughly 0.125–0.4 percent of vessel value per voyage in peacetime — reached about 3 percent by 6 March, according to Reuters' reporting from London brokers: on a typical $250 million tanker, about $7.5 million per transit. By late July, Lloyd's List reported quotes for high-risk vessels at 10 percent of hull value, in the double-digit millions of dollars per trip, and trade sources described premiums of 7.5–10 percent across the tanker segment. For a VLCC carrying two million barrels, a 10 percent premium works out to roughly $0.50–0.55 per barrel of cargo on its own — before freight, before the escort delays, before the risk of the voyage not completing. The premium has come off its extremes at various points, but no source describes it as having returned to pre-war levels; the market's insurers, unlike its futures traders, never priced the war away.

Freight and transit counts. The oil shipping index that peaked at 3,737 in March stood at 1,850 in July — down by half, but far above pre-crisis levels. Transit counts after the memorandum's expiry (73 in the week of 10–16 August, against 91 the prior week and several hundred in a normal week on the pre-war baseline) put physical traffic back at a fraction of normal. Kpler's post-MoU reading — 6.1 million barrels per day exiting the Gulf against a 15 million baseline — is the same measurement in volume terms: at summer's end, roughly 60 percent of the system's normal throughput was still missing.
The human ledger. The International Maritime Organization counted 46 attacks on commercial shipping as of 11 June, with 14 seafarers killed; by 20 August the count of dead had reached at least 18, including a crew member of the bulker Minoan Dignity killed on 18 August — the first confirmed death since July. The IMO also reported, at the June date, roughly 1,000 ships and 20,000 crew held in the Arabian Gulf by the crisis, a stranding then more than 100 days old. US forces have acknowledged about half a dozen of the attacks, including a 10 June strike on a Palau-flagged tanker that killed three Indian seafarers; no government has claimed the August attack. These counts, unlike futures prices, have no round trip in them.
The gas market that did not come back. QatarEnergy declared force majeure on LNG exports on 4 March; an 18 March strike on the inactive Ras Laffan industrial complex cut Qatar's liquefaction capacity by a reported 17 percent, with damage estimated at three to five years to repair. European gas prices nearly doubled to above €60/MWh in March — the mechanism by which a Middle East war reached European industry, whose chemical and steel producers imposed surcharges of up to 30 percent. Asia LNG spot rose by more than 140 percent. The MoU's expiry leaves the LNG strand of the crisis substantially unresolved: liquefaction capacity, unlike a strait, cannot be reopened by escort.
How the shock ranks against the oil crises on record
The comparisons that matter are with the four shocks the market actually remembers. In 1973–74, the Arab oil embargo's peak loss was about 4.5 million barrels per day, and the price quadrupled in months. In 1979, the Iranian revolution removed Iranian output — 4.8 million barrels per day by January, roughly 7 percent of then-world production, by the US Federal Reserve's historical account — with peak disruptions estimated at 5.6 million; because the loss persisted through the revolution's chaos, 1979 still holds the record for cumulative barrels lost, as the Arab Weekly's July comparison noted. In 1990, Iraq's invasion erased Kuwaiti and Iraqi exports for months. In 2022, Russia's oil was never physically removed — only re-routed.
On daily loss, 2026 exceeds all of them: the four Gulf producers' reported losses reached 6.7 million barrels per day within ten days of closure and estimates of 10 million or more by 12 March, and a comparison study published in September put the war's outright daily loss above both the 1973–74 and 1979 peaks. On cumulative loss, the war has not yet caught 1979 — a function of duration, not intensity, and one reason the historical framing matters: a six-week shock at 2026's tempo is survivable; a two-year one is a different object, which is precisely what the market's remaining $20–30 premium is pricing as an open question.
How unusual was the round trip?
Against the market's own history, the 2026 episode's price behaviour was conventional and its policy response was not.
The price comparison first. Brent's peak — about $118, 63 percent above the pre-war level — sits well below the multi-fold price increases of the 1973–74 and 1979 embargoes, and its four-month return to the pre-war level matches the pattern the Congressional Research Service documented for the 1990–91 Gulf War and the 2003 Iraq War: sharp initial spikes, then reversion within months once sustained supply was established. The 2022 episode — a spike toward $130 after Russia's invasion, then a multi-month decline — is the immediate precedent. In each earlier case, however, the underlying physical supply recovered on its own timetable. In 2026 the physical disruption persisted through and beyond the price round trip, held down deliberately in part by one side of the war and only partially reopened by the other.
The policy comparison is where 2026 stands alone. The 400-million-barrel IEA release is the largest collective action in the agency's history — more than twice the 2022 release, six times 2011 — and it was agreed within twelve days of the closure, an improvisation speed the agency's earlier crises did not require. Whether the precedent is stabilising or dangerous is a question analysts have already begun to dispute: a market that has learned producers of last resort can bridge even a Hormuz-scale closure may price future closures differently, and several commentators noted through the summer that the same expectation may have contributed to the speed of the price's decline. That interpretation is plausible and unproven; it is noted here because it will be tested by the next closure, not resolved by this one.
The American pump and the political timer
The futures round trip stopped at the refinery gate. US gasoline averaged above $4 per gallon on 31 March for the first time since 2022 — up more than 30 percent since the strikes began, after a week in early March in which pump prices jumped 48 cents, per AAA's daily tracking through CBS. The pre-war national average had been $2.89–$3.22 in early March. And the round trip never reached the pump: NBC's running national price page still showed an average above $4 per gallon in mid-September, six months in.
The gap between the futures curve and the filling station is structural — retail prices lag crude, and refining margins widened when Gulf-origin product flows tightened — but its political arithmetic is simple. The war entered its sixth month with US midterm campaigns underway and pump prices still roughly a third above their pre-war level, which makes the administration's "the strait is open" claims a matter of domestic politics as much as maritime fact. It also gives both negotiators a standing incentive to produce a durable agreement before winter heating demand tests the gas market the same way the spring tested oil.
The gas crisis running on its own clock
Oil had substitutes and stocks. Qatari LNG had neither. The emirate's liquefaction complex at Ras Laffan — the world's largest — shipped its cargoes exclusively through the strait, and on 4 March QatarEnergy declared force majeure on all of them. European gas benchmarks nearly doubled to above €60/MWh within two weeks, arriving into storage that stood near 30 percent after a cold winter; Asian spot LNG rose more than 140 percent after the 18 March strike on Ras Laffan's industrial city, which cut Qatar's liquefaction capacity by a reported 17 percent, with damage the company indicated would take years to repair.
The consequences ran through two economies at once. Europe's — where the ECB postponed planned rate cuts on 19 March, raised its inflation forecast, and warned of stagflation risks for energy-intensive members, and where chemical and steel producers imposed surcharges of up to 30 percent — and Asia's, where Pakistan and Bangladesh faced price shocks they could barely absorb and where buyers who had built terminals specifically around Qatari cargoes had no workaround at all. A pipeline cannot substitute for an LNG train: unlike crude, which found partial exits, Qatar's gas simply stopped. This is the strand of the crisis with no round trip and no bypass — its recovery runs on repair schedules, not diplomacy, and it will outlast whatever the strait does next.
The sanctions layer bending in real time
Sanctions policy, normally the slowest instrument in the US toolkit, moved at market speed. On 21 June 2026, amid the memorandum's diplomacy, OFAC issued General License X authorising transactions involving Iranian-origin crude oil and petrochemicals, per the Congressional Research Service's August chronology — a formal carve-out in the very restrictions built over a decade to exclude those cargoes, granted while the war continued. The permission was framed as part of the June understanding; its survival beyond the memorandum's expiry remained unclear at this report's cutoff, with the administration simultaneously threatening what it called economic warfare against countries continuing to facilitate Iranian exports.
The episode documents something larger than one licence. The 2026 crisis forced the sanctions architecture — designed to make Iranian oil untouchable — to coexist with an active market in Iranian oil: Iran-approved cargoes moving under escort from the war's first weeks, Chinese and Indian buyers still lifting, a general licence authorising what the blocked strait had already normalised. Whether that coexistence reverts after the war, or hardens into a permanent dual system — sanctioned in law, flowing in fact — is among the war's most consequential open questions for energy markets.
What would change this reading
The report's interpretation rests on measurements that will keep moving, and four of them could alter it materially. A durable reopening — transit counts sustained in the hundreds per week, war-risk quotes back toward 1 percent — would confirm that the round trip was a leading indicator of recovery rather than a policy artefact, and the EIA's outlook path (about $90 averaging through late 2026, declining toward $74 in 2027) describes exactly that expectation. A renewed full closure would test the bridging mechanism at depth: the IEA's remaining billion barrels of emergency stocks against a closure measured in quarters rather than weeks, with the 2022 experience of re-routing no longer available as an offset. The bypass pipelines' mid-2027 timelines — the UAE's expansion to 3.6 million barrels per day chief among them — will change the strait's structural leverage permanently if completed on schedule. And Ras Laffan's repair clock will keep the gas crisis alive regardless of every other series in this report. Each of these is observable in public data, which is the appropriate end for a measurement-driven report: the findings are falsifiable, and the falsification schedule is itself published.
The macro bill, as currently measurable
The crisis's macroeconomic costs are accumulating in data that will be revised, and only their broad shape is worth stating now. The IMF's July revision kept 2026 global growth at 3.0 percent — the shock absorbed, per the Fund's own statement, by the AI investment cycle and the offsetting adjustments documented above. The regional costs are larger: a UNDP study of 30 March estimated $120–194 billion of lost growth across Arab states; European energy-intensive industry took surcharges and recession warnings; and the Gulf's own economic model — import-dependent food systems carrying 80 percent of caloric intake through the strait, desalination-dependent water systems, aviation hubs — absorbed the direct hit, including a 40–120 percent consumer price spike in Gulf retail during the closure weeks. Interest-rate paths bent: the ECB postponed planned reductions on 19 March and raised its inflation forecast, and the Federal Reserve's timetable came under equivalent pressure from US gasoline prices that rose several cents a gallon daily through March.
Against that bill, the market's own verdict — Brent near $103 on 18 September, the EIA's September outlook averaging ~$90 for 2H26 before an expected decline to $74 in 2027 — implies the market believes the remaining crisis is worth a partial premium, not a structural re-pricing. The EIA's 2H26 average of $90 against the pre-war low-$70s is, in effect, the futures market's standing estimate of a partially-blocked Hormuz.
What the public data cannot establish
Three quantities that would sharpen this report's conclusions are not publicly observable, and their absence shapes what follows. First, the physical ownership of the floating oil: how much crude sits in blockade-delayed tankers, owned by whom, financed by whom — the inventory overhang that would tell us whether the MoU-window surge borrowed from future flows. Second, actual delivered costs to the Asian refiners who take three-quarters of Hormuz crude; published benchmarks are London and New York contracts, and the discount structures the crisis forced on Chinese and Indian buyers are contract terms, not market data. Third, the unreported flows: Iran-approved cargoes, shadow-fleet movements and ship-to-ship transfers that tanker trackers acknowledge under-counting, which means the measured 2.3 and 6.1 million barrel figures are floors, not totals. Each gap biases the flow picture toward understatement, which in turn means the price round trip is, if anything, somewhat less anomalous against true physical volumes than it appears against measured ones — though not by an amount anyone can currently quantify.
Conclusion
The 2026 Hormuz crisis produced the largest measured supply disruption in the oil market's history and the largest emergency response to match — 400 million barrels of coordinated release agreed within twelve days, 290 million delivered by mid-summer, into inventories that entered the crisis at multi-year highs. The price response was severe and brief: $118 within a month, the pre-war level regained within four, a partial premium — roughly $20 to $30 per barrel — established since. The physical system has not followed the price: insurance premia remain at multiples of peacetime rates, transit counts remain a fraction of baseline, and Qatar's LNG capacity, damaged in March, remains on a years-long repair clock regardless of what the strait does next.
What the episode demonstrates, on the evidence assembled here, is that the price of crude in 2026 measured the market's confidence in bridging mechanisms — stocks, substitutes, diplomacy — at least as much as it measured the flow of oil through the strait. That distinction has a practical edge for anyone consuming the price signal: a Brent quote in this crisis was a statement about expected policy and diplomacy, and only indirectly about barrels. The barrels themselves — the transit counts, the insurance quotes, the loaded tankers outside the chokepoint — told a slower, less optimistic story, and they are the series to read if the question is what the physical market is actually doing.

Appendix B. Method notes
Price series. The report uses only Brent observations that each carry a named source (Table A1). Where two sources report the same date, the compiled figure and the agency figure agree ($118 vs $118.35 for the quarter-end; "below $71" vs $71.57 for 1–2 July). Intermediate dates are omitted rather than interpolated; the arc between them is described qualitatively.
Flow series. EIA transit volumes (crude + condensate + products through the strait) and Kpler Gulf-exit cargo volumes are different populations and are never added, averaged or directly ratioed against each other in this report; each chart and table states its basis. The "roughly 40 percent of normal" and "roughly 60 percent missing" figures are Kpler-basis comparisons, as published by the source itself.
Release-rate derivation. The ~2 million barrels per day figure for IEA delivery is derived from 290 million barrels over roughly 130 days (11 March–21 July); it is an average, not a constant observed rate, and the IEA does not publish a daily series. It is used only for order-of-magnitude comparison with the measured flow shortfall.
Insurance arithmetic. The per-barrel premium estimate applies a 7.5–10 percent hull premium to a VLCC cargo value derived from reported vessel values and typical cargo sizes; it is a derived illustration of scale, not a quoted market rate, and individual voyages vary widely.
Attribution. Characterisations of causality in this report are stated at the strength the evidence supports: timing and scale correlations for the stock release, forward-looking pricing mechanics for the futures response, and attributed analyst views where the literature offers competing weights. No single-cause claim is made for the price round trip.
